The Rock has now teased a confrontation with the Bloodline, sending a message to the WWE stars ahead of WrestleMania 39 Sunday.

This WrestleMania weekend has been a big one for the Anoa’i family, with The Rock’s daughter Ava Raine (Simone Johnson) making her WWE TV in-ring debut ahead of Saturday’s (April 1) NXT Stand & Deliver.

Later that night, Sami Zayn and Kevin Owens defeated The Usos to win the WWE Tag Team Championship in the main event of WrestleMania 39 night one.

Following the show, The Rock shared a video to Twitter, celebrating his family.

The Hollywood star noted that he’s looking forward to the main event of WrestleMania 39 Sunday, with Roman Reigns set to defend his WWE Undisputed Universal Title against Cody Rhodes.

Hinting that he’ll meet with the Bloodline face to face in the future, The Rock said:

“I’m looking forward to all the matches, but especially the main event. Roman Reigns, my cousin, the Universal Champion, and to my family, The entire Bloodline – Jey, Jimmy, Solo – we’re so proud of you guys.

“And who knows? Maybe, just maybe, down the road, I’ll see you in person.”

It was originally reported in 2022 that WWE had plans for Roman Reigns vs The Rock to headline WrestleMania 39, as long as The Rock had time in his schedule to train for an in-ring return.

A follow-up report in January stated that The Rock didn’t feel he would be able to get into ring shape ahead of the event.
